We are trying to establish a linked server in SQL 2005 using QB version 8 release R5P.  I believe we have everyting setup correctly but we are still seeing the linked server show below.

We have spent countless hours looking over the forumns and I am hoping we are we are just over looking something simple.

The VB Demo works fine.  We have linked the table to Access and that works perfectly.

We ran the DCOM config application dcpinst.exe
We ran the Test DCOM Script in SQL and received All Success results.

We have looked through the following pages and ran through them multiple times rebooting when necessary.  

Ran This: Does QODBC work with MS SQL Server 2005 Linked Tables? 
Ran This: MS SQL Server 2000 Linked Server issue using the QODBC optimizer  

The error we are seeing is:


OLE DB provider "MSDASQL" for linked server "QODBC" returned message "[Microsoft][ODBC Driver Manager] Driver's SQLSetConnectAttr failed".
OLE DB provider "MSDASQL" for linked server "QODBC" returned message "[QODBC] QB Open Connection Failed. Create DCOM Instance Error = 8000401a, Unknown error.. Created qbXMLRP2 OK.
".
Msg 7303, Level 16, State 1, Line 1
Cannot initialize the data source object of OLE DB provider "MSDASQL" for linked server "QODBC".

Any help would be appreciated.
